Форум: "Базы";
Текущий архив: 2004.06.27;
Скачать: [xml.tar.bz2];
ВнизВопрос по DBGrig и базы AidAim EasyTable 6 Найти похожие ветки
← →
Victor_A (2004-05-27 07:58) [0]А как можно скопировать текущую запись (в DBGrid) и вставить в эту же таблицу - т.е. сделать копия записи внутри одной и той же базы.
И второй вопрос - как можно произвести реиндексацию?
А то когда записи удаляешь, порядковый номер (я использовал ID - autoinc) нумеруется не по порядку
← →
Sergey13 © (2004-05-27 09:44) [1]2Victor_A (27.05.04 07:58)
>А как можно скопировать текущую запись (в DBGrid) и вставить в эту же таблицу - т.е. сделать копия записи внутри одной и той же базы.
Ну... Если принять во внимание, что в гриде нет записей, как и в базе, а есть они в датасете (табл или квери) и в таблицах базы, то подход достаточно очевиден - скопируй поля копируемой записи в переменные, добавь новую запись и присвой полям значение переменных.
>И второй вопрос - как можно произвести реиндексацию?
А то когда записи удаляешь, порядковый номер (я использовал ID - autoinc) нумеруется не по порядку
Ну... Если принять во внимание, что переиндексация никак не связана с autoinc и естественно ничего не меняет, то и применять ее по этому поводу не стОит. Нумеруется autoinc по порядку, но ты его (этот порядок) нарушаешь удалением. Выход - или не autoinc, или не удалять, или (самое правильное) забить на эти "дыры" и не огорчаться по пустякам.
← →
Victor_A (2004-05-27 14:01) [2]2 Sergey13 - так что, никак нельзя эти самые "дыры" в порядковом номере залотать или сдвинуть???
← →
Sergey13 © (2004-05-28 08:48) [3]2Victor_A (27.05.04 14:01) [2]
>так что, никак нельзя эти самые "дыры" в порядковом номере залотать или сдвинуть???
Ну...Если принять во внимание, что сделать можно почти все, то можно и это. Вопрос стоит ли это делать, так ли страшны эти "дыры"? И еще подсказка, код и номер записи в документах могут быть разными полями в таблице.
← →
Victor_A (2004-05-28 14:14) [4]Так я использую в качестве порядкового номера код записи!
← →
Sergey13 © (2004-05-28 16:20) [5]2Victor_A (28.05.04 14:14) [4]
>Так я использую в качестве порядкового номера код записи!
А я и говорю, что можно по другому. 8-)
← →
Victor_A (2004-05-31 06:59) [6]Хорошо, с этим разобрались ...
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2004.06.27;
Скачать: [xml.tar.bz2];
Память: 0.45 MB
Время: 0.028 c